The 1998 Florida Attorney General election was held on November 3, 1998. Democratic incumbent Bob Butterworth defeated Republican nominee David H. Bludworth with 59.56% of the vote. As of 2022, this is the most recent time a Democrat was elected Florida Attorney General .
Primary elections [ ]
Primary elections were held on September 1, 1998.[1]
